Gearboxes/timing pinions very tough on Triumph T140 machines, only a problem with early Electric start mechs. If it's like a metallic rustling which gets louder, like tin-tacks rattling round, it could well be the timing, which if allied to slightly out of sinc carbs, well that can make quite a din, if you also have the timing side coil going down as well....
swap the coils over and see if there's any improvement, that'll get the coil out or into the equation. Also it sounds like the seal has gone on the cam.
If your still running a Lucas RITA Ignition, it may well be getting to the end of its natural.
